Gebrina Roberts is a seasoned professional with over twenty years of accounting and bookkeeping experience.
After 15 years in the private sector, Gebrina has recently turned her focus to the nonprofit sector, recognizing the potential to use her skills to help those who help others.
With every client, Gebrina works to ensure that institutions have the highest quality accounting and bookkeeping services available, creating records and functional financial documents which are readily accessible and understandable to board members, owners, donors, and fiscal officers.
Gebrina performs all professional bookkeeping/business management and accounting functions in accordance with prescribed internal accounting systems and GAAP.
Professional memberships current as of March 1, 2021 include:
AAN - American Association of Notaries
AIPB - American Institute of Professional Bookkeepers
AICPA - American Institute of Certified Public Accountants Student Affiliate Member
ANAFP - Association of Nonprofit Accountants and Finance Professionals
NATP - National Association of Tax Professionals
